Abundance is a book about why we cannot build housing, energy, or a train on time, and why the people who say they want those things keep getting in the way of them. It is clearer than most policy books. It is also a little pleased with itself, which is the Klein brand.

I dog-eared pages and still wanted more about who loses when you 'just build.' Read it anyway. The pile of American nonfiction is full of worse.

Worth it if you care how a country actually gets a train built. Not a beach read.
